Sportsbet, McDonald’s, CBUS, KIA: Foxtel Media unveils new and returning sponsors for 2024 NRL season

The sponsorship announcement follows Round One at Allegiant Stadium in Las Vegas.

Foxtel Media has unveiled the line up of new and returning brands sponsoring the 2024 NRL season.

The sponsors include Sportsbet, McDonald’s, CBUS, KIA, KFC, TAB, VB, McCain, Ford, Red Rooster, Harvey Norman, Jim Beam, Chemist Warehouse, Toyota Material Handling, Telstra, Musashi, Drummond, Hungry Jacks, Steel Blue Boots, AAMI, Toyota and Ashley & Martin.

This comes after Round One kicked off in Las Vegas at Allegiant Stadium, with four clubs— Manly Sea Eagles playing the South Sydney Rabbitohs, and Sydney Roosters against the Brisbane Broncos—competing in the international double-header.

The Manly Sea Eagles and Sydney Roosters both emerged victorious from the games and broke records for the Foxtel Group, becoming the #1 and #2 most-watched NRL games of all time.

Round One also emerged as the highest-performing opening NRL round of all time across Foxtel Group platforms.

The Brisbane Magic Round in May is expected to also pull audiences. Fox League and Kayo Sports will also air 121 exclusive matches this year.

, director of Sports Sales and Brand Partnerships at Foxtel Media, said Foxtel's technology and premium environment will add to the excitement of the season ahead.
 
"With our commitment to no ad breaks in live play, reduced ad clutter and high quality programs, we’re confident this is another record breaking season. It’s an incredible time for our partner brands to reach unparalleled audience numbers and to add to the fans viewing experience."
